The Team leader is responsible for the day-to-day operation of the warehouse, managing a group of operators and ensuring an efficient warehouse operation in achieving business targets. Provide line management to the team, coordinating their workloads, providing support to ensure that the team delivers, monitoring any issues, and ensuring operational targets, KPIs, and quality standards are met to meet customer requirements. Develop the team by focusing on individual performance and support requirements to achieve high standards, whilst fostering a culture of working safely.

Forklift Management
Ensure that the pre-inspection trip sheet is completed at the beginning of each shift
Ensure forklifts are charged and batteries maintained accordingly to the training provided
Report faults to respective service providers; conduct Incident/Accident investigations
Daily analysis of FMX is sent to management daily

Human resources
Discipline of Drivers failing to follow their working procedures (i.e. not parking with their respective chock-blocks in place, not wearing their respective PPE, not filling in their pre-trip inspections correctly on log sheets)
Report all Line-haul drivers who are not adhering to the site rules (i.e. not wearing the correct uniform on site)
Discipline of all staff members (floor staff) on site who do not wear the correct PPE
